Project “Procedures and methods for release of materials from regulatory control” is heading into the homestretch

The project U4.01/10E “Procedures and methods for release of materials from regulatory control” funded by the European Commission has completed successfully as per schedule.  

Upon completion of the expert review, the State Nuclear Regulatory Inspectorate of Ukraine (the SNRIU) has issued a positive conclusion regarding the document “Methodology for release of radioactive materials from regulatory control”. The methodology establishes general methodological provisions as basis for the ChNPP and other enterprises, which carry out practical activity in the area of nuclear energy utilization, to elaborate their own definite standards for release of materials from regulatory control.

Development of “Methodology for release of radioactive materials from regulatory control” is one of the key tasks under U4.01/10E project ““Procedures and methods for release of materials from regulatory control”. Previously, in the framework of this project one more task was completed, namely: elaboration of tender dossier for the following stage - design and construction of a facility for release of ChNPP materials. The EC on basis of the developed documentation held a tender; and on 18.12.2015, the appropriate Contract was awarded and now it is being implemented at the ChNPP.

Moreover, in the framework of this project the procedures and manuals for release of materials have been elaborated to be applied at Chernobyl NPP.

U4.01/10E project “Methodology for release of radioactive materials from regulatory control” has been implemented since April 2014 under contract between the EC and NUVIA a.s. (the Czech Republic). The main objective of the project is to support safe and efficient management of radioactive waste, which is subject to disposal in high-technology facilities, by minimization of waste production.
